I want to know how to take off the instrument panel garnish?

I got new defroster grille for my 1989 GTU and I was wondering what is the best way to take off the defrost panel. I took off the center cap bolt off, but I can’t get it off. I was wondering if I needed to take off part of the dash or pry it with something.

There are several metal clips that hold the panel down. Also at least one of the a-pillars should be removed to get the panel in and out easily. Technically you can flex it out, but it's a real struggle. Just remove an a-pillar and make your life easier.
